The purpose of this study is to explore the therapeutic effect and mechanism of transcranial magnetic stimulation (rTMS) in the treatment of the tardive dyskinesia.
The study was a parallel control design trial for 2 weeks. Patients with schizophrenia were treated with 10-Hz rTMS on left motor cortex (added to the ongoing treatment). Clinical symptoms and MEP were assessment before and after rTMS treatment.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| tardive dyskinesia group | Active Comparator | tardive dyskinesia group will be delivered at an intensity that is 80% of the resting motor threshold (RMT). Stimulation will be delivered at 10 Hz with 60 stimulation trains of 30 stimuli each (i.e., 1800 stimuli) and an intertrain interval of 12 sec in primary motor cortex(M1). |
